In this review of GRADYS COLD BREW New Orleans Style Bean Bags, the bottom line is simple: this is for anyone who wants rich, cafe-quality cold brew at home without equipment or fuss. The product stands out because it blends 100% Arabica coffee with imported French chicory and a touch of spice, producing a naturally sweeter, smoother concentrate that rivals shop-bought cold brew while costing roughly a dollar per drink. Preparation is nearly foolproof - steep a bean bag in cold water for 12-24 hours - so busy mornings and weekend batches are both covered.
Key Features
- Blend: 100% Arabica coffee combined with imported French chicory and spice gives a distinct New Orleans-style flavor that is naturally sweeter and less bitter than plain coffee.
- All-natural formulas: The pouches are sugar-free, vegan, low calorie, non-GMO, and gluten-free so they fit most dietary preferences without added ingredients.
- Ultra convenient brewing: Bean Bags steep in cold water for 12-24 hours with no special equipment required, making cold brew as easy as soak-and-serve.
- Concentrate storage: Brewed concentrate keeps refrigerated for up to one week, letting you make larger batches and pour a drink anytime.
- Versatility: The concentrate is strong enough to drink black or dilute with water, milk, or other mixers for a wide range of drinks from iced lattes to baking or cocktails.
- Value: Six bundles of four 2 oz bean bags make up to 72 servings of concentrate, working out to roughly one dollar per drink compared with coffee-shop prices.

Specifications
| Brand | Grady's Cold Brew |
| Style | New Orleans Style with chicory and spice |
| Format | 2 oz Bean Bags, 6 bundles of 4 bags (24 bags) |
| Yield | Each bag brews 3 servings of concentrate; up to 72 drinks total |
| Storage | Brewed concentrate refrigerated for up to one week |
| Dietary | Sugar-free, vegan, low calorie, non-GMO, gluten-free |
| Made | New York City |

Frequently Asked Questions
How long should I steep a bean bag?
Steep each bean bag in cold water for 12-24 hours depending on your desired strength, then refrigerate the concentrate.
How much concentrate does each bag make?
Each 2 oz bean bag brews roughly three servings of concentrate; the package contains six bundles of four bags for up to 72 drinks total.
How long does the brewed concentrate keep?
Keep the concentrated brew in the fridge and use within one week for best flavor and freshness.
